PREPARAtIoN oF FRUIt AND VEGEtABlES FoR PUREE ExtRACtoR
Only soft fruits should be used with the Puree
Extractor.
When using fruits with hard inedible skins,
such as mangoes, pineapple or kiwi fruit,
always peel before juicing.
When using fruits with a hard core such as
pineapple, always remove this before juicing.
All fruits with pits, hard seeds or stones
such as nectarines, peaches, mangoes and
apricots must be pitted or deseeded before
juicing.
Passionfruit pulp, peeled kiwi fruit and berries
can be processed without removing seeds.

NOTE: When using the Puree Extractor
only use Speed 1. Always ensure motor
is running before adding fruit and/or
vegetables to feed tube.
